Abstract

In this paper, we proposed a self-automated Robot chassis car along with an obstacle detection technique. The main idea behind this paper is to reduce collision that occurs from accidents on roads. To achieve this, several methods are performed such as lane, stop sign, and object detection. It contains various terminology based on deep learning to perform image processing and machine learning. To determinewe had used a pi camera attached to the raspberry pi board to collect input images to steam data over a server. In our case laptop will acts as a server. Here, a neural network and Haar-based cascade classifier are used for obstacles detections. In addition to this, our designed model incorporates self-controlling such as left-right turn, forward-backward turn, and U-turn based on Arduino commands. In a nutshell, the proposed model helps humans to reduce efforts and improve safety along with collision avoidance.
